Isaac Success FC, Dinamo Academica battle for Kators Cup top prize

The stage is now set for the final match of the maiden edition of Kators Cup football tournament for youth teams in Edo State.

The week long soccer carnival which kicked off May 14th, 2021, will come to a climax on Sunday, May 23rd, 2021, at the Western  Boys High School Sports Complex, Ikpoba Hill, Benin City with two top teams Isaac Success Football Club and Dinamo Academica,  battling for the coveted trophy.

Isaac Success Football Club owned by Watford and  Super Eagles striker, Isaac Success, defeated tournament favourite Shooting Arrow Fc 5-4 on penalties after scores at  regulation time  stood at 1-1 while Dinamo Academica edged out Rolly FC  4-3 also via penalties after goalless draw at full time.

Cup donor and sponsor, USA based football administrator and scout , Osaigie Christopher Ekhator, said, he is satisfied with what he has seen in the last one week of football action in Benin City, adding that some talents have been identified good enough to play outside the shores of Nigeria.

“I am happy to be part of this, and I must admit I have enjoyed watching these young boys since the start of the tournament, myself and friends have identify  some talents good enough to earn deals abroad and that is my mission.

“I want to commend my friends who put up a good organization to ensure the success of this tournament including those who have supported the program and the fans.

“I also want to thank Edo State Government for  providing the facility for us to engage these youth, we shall expand the tournament next year,” Ekhator stated.

Ekhator, who is an ex footballer, used the opportunity to thank  BellPoint Energy Limited that has decided to partner Kators football tournament in its bid to continue their investment in the developmental enhancement of young talents in Nigeria.

Shooting Arrow FC will slug it out with Rolly FC for the losers final on Sunday, May 23rd, 2021, by 1pm. 

According to the organizing committee chairman, Joseph Isokpehi, cash prizes, medals, individual awards, and tournament souvenirs will be given out to  the winners during the closing ceremony.
